Subject: [PATCH 3/9] xfs: cull unnecessary icdinode fields

Now that the struct xfs_icdinode is not directly related to the
on-disk format, we can cull things in it we really don't need to
store:
- magic number never changes
- padding is not necessary
- next_unlinked is never used
- inode number is redundant
- uuid is redundant
- lsn is accessed directly from dinode
- inode CRC is only accessed directly from dinode
Hence we can remove these from the struct xfs_icdinode and redirect
the code that uses them to the xfs_dinode appripriately. This
reduces the size of the struct icdinode from 152 bytes to 88 bytes,
and removes a fair chunk of unnecessary code, too.
